ABHISHEK_SINGH - PeerSpot reviewer
Senior Process Expert at A.P. Moller - Maersk
Gained full visibility and streamlined threat detection through behavior-based insights and AI integration
Initially, we got to have a lot of false positives when we onboarded, but nowadays it's quite smooth. We have fine-tuned our security policies and allowed different levels of policies to get rid of those false positives. Currently, we are getting a fairly good amount of incidents that are not false positives or benign, but actionable items. The process is streamlined. In the initial days, the operations used to get involved in a lot of benign and other activities, but now the process is streamlined. We are leveraging the auto-detection and remediation plans. The operations teams are now more involved in other business roles as well, not just looking into the logs and fetching out what's happening there. They have fixed a lot of things. Initially, they didn't have IAC code drift detection, cloud posture management, or security posture management, but they have those now. They purchased different vendors and did a merger with that. They have now Prisma Cloud that gets integrated and now they are working with Cortex Cloud. Everything that was negative has now been addressed, and the product altogether looks to be in a very better and mature shape now. Currently, it's more or less detecting the workloads with AI-based best practices. Since most organizations are consuming AI agents and other things, we are looking forward to seeing what other feature enhancements Palo Alto can support in that.

reviewer2793894 - PeerSpot reviewer
Platform Engineer Ii at a outsourcing company with 5,001-10,000 employees
Centralized cloud view has improved threat response and simplified compliance reporting
We are using Trend Vision One - Cloud Security for getting complete visibility of all the assets that exist within our cloud, and it helps us identify any sort of misconfigurations or fine-tuning that can be done to better our compliance. Trend Vision One - Cloud Security helps in onboarding all the cloud solutions or cloud providers that we have within our organization into a single dashboard, thereby providing greater visibility of all the assets. Earlier we used to have multiple dashboards to manage the same solution or capability, but with Trend Micro, we are able to get everything in a single pane of glass, benefiting our operations significantly. We are using the playbooks built into Trend Vision One - Cloud Security, which help us take a lot of response actions and bring automation capabilities into play. Trend Vision One - Cloud Security has positively impacted our organization by providing a single pane of glass visibility across all the cloud solutions that we have and reducing the number of threats we used to see earlier in the cloud. We are seeing that the number of cloud operations required earlier in terms of threat detection and response, and the time taken to detect a particular threat and take a response action, has considerably improved after onboarding Trend Micro.
